    I'm getting tired of topping off the steering box in my 1960 F100. It is leaking at the pitman shaft. My big question is whether or not the seal passes through the frame, or does the box need to come out? Any other tips?

    I pulled one out the bottom of a 56 once , it was on a lift though .. Removed steering wheel and Un clamped the column .. I had to pull the sector out a tad to get another inch of clearance
